Detailed Ingredients with measures
Pasta sheets: 12 sheets
Ham: 200 grams, thinly sliced
Broccoli: 300 grams, cooked and chopped
Ricotta cheese: 250 grams
Mozzarella cheese: 200 grams, grated
Parmesan cheese: 50 grams, grated
Egg: 1
Salt: to taste
Pepper: to taste
Olive oil: 2 tablespoons
Italian herbs: 1 teaspoon
Prep Time
20 minutes
Cook Time, Total Time, Yield
Cook Time: 30 minutes
Total Time: 50 minutes
Yield: Serves 4-6 people
Detailed Directions and Instructions
Step 1: Prepare the Broccoli
Begin by washing and trimming the broccoli into small florets. Steam the florets for about 5 minutes until they are tender but still vibrant green. Once cooked, set aside to cool.
Step 2: Cook the Lasagna Sheets
In a large pot, bring water to a boil and add a pinch of salt. Carefully add the lasagna sheets and cook them according to package instructions until al dente. Drain and lay them flat on a kitchen towel to cool.
Step 3: Prepare the Filling
In a mixing bowl, combine the cooked broccoli, diced ham, and a portion of the shredded cheese. Mix well until all the ingredients are evenly distributed.
Step 4: Assemble the Lasagna Rolls
Take a lasagna sheet and place a generous amount of the filling at one end. Roll it tightly to form a cylinder. Repeat this process for all the sheets and filling.
Step 5: Prepare the Baking Dish
Preheat your oven to 180°C (350°F). In a baking dish, spread a thin layer of béchamel sauce at the bottom to prevent sticking.
Step 6: Place the Rolls in the Dish
Arrange the rolled lasagna pieces side by side in the baking dish, ensuring they are snug but not overcrowded.
Step 7: Add the Sauce and Cheese
Pour the remaining béchamel sauce over the lasagna rolls, making sure they are well-coated. Sprinkle the remaining shredded cheese evenly on top.
Step 8: Bake the Lasagna Rolls
Cover the baking dish with aluminum foil and place it in the preheated oven. Bake for about 25 minutes, then remove the foil and bake for an additional 10-15 minutes until the top is golden and bubbly.
Step 9: Let it Rest
Once out of the oven, let the lasagna rolls rest for a few minutes before serving. This allows the filling to set and makes it easier to serve.
Notes
Ingredient Substitutions
Feel free to substitute ham with cooked chicken or a plant-based alternative for a varied flavor and dietary preference.
Storage Recommendations
Leftovers can be stored in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. Reheat in the oven or microwave before serving.
Serving Suggestions
These lasagna rolls pair well with a fresh garden salad or garlic bread for a complete meal.

Cook techniques
Preparing the Broccoli
To retain the vibrant color and essential nutrients, blanch the broccoli before adding it to the lasagna. This involves boiling it briefly and then plunging it into ice water.
Making the Cheese Mixture
Combine cheese types like ricotta and mozzarella with eggs and seasonings to create a creamy filling that binds the layers of the lasagna together effectively.
Rolling the Lasagna
Instead of layering, spread the filling on each lasagna sheet, roll them tightly, and place them upright in the baking dish. This method allows for even cooking and a unique presentation.
Assembling the Dish
Layer the rolled lasagna with sauce and cheese in the baking dish. Ensure to cover all surfaces with sauce to prevent drying during baking.
Baking Techniques
Bake at a moderate temperature to ensure the cheese melts and forms a golden, bubbly topping while allowing the flavors to meld. Cover with foil initially to streamline cooking.
FAQ
Can I use different vegetables instead of broccoli?
Yes, you can substitute other vegetables like spinach, zucchini, or mushrooms based on your preference.
How do I store leftover lasagna rolls?
Store le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to three days or freeze them for longer storage.
Can I prepare the lasagna rolls ahead of time?
Yes, you can prepare the rolls in advance and refrigerate them before baking. Just ensure to add a bit of sauce to keep them moist.
What types of cheese can I use in the filling?
You can use a variety of cheeses like cottage cheese, ricotta, or a blend of mozzarella and parmesan for a richer flavor.
How do I know when the lasagna is done baking?
The lasagna is done when the cheese is bubbly and golden, and the sauce is simmering around the edges.
